A DEAD CHILD’S DREAM
by Sorana Lucia Salomeia


Blurred emotions I cannot name,
Images I could never define…

I bear their revolted anger
Come against my uncertain visions.

Monstrous winters I hear
Menacing to bury me alive
Under the illusion of fragile perfection –
There is nothing I could pretend to be!

Glimpses of childhood’s perfection
I watch falling from above –
A blind, innocent child
Whose only wish was to die…

A grown up child with the face of an infant
Stretching one little hand for me to grab
And save her
Before the ferocious fountains of blood
Would swallow her helpless body forever.

A thousand feet I hear approaching obsessively,
Yet I cannot distinguish any shape;
It is the starving earthquakes
Sending their warriors
Towards this cathedral of madness.

I startle…

Frozen as the moon’s green eyes,
I rise from my sleeping shelter…

The angel in the corner, with its head bent in agony,
Is pointing to the window…

The wind is dancing
Through the fluttering ragged curtains of snow
That have so thoroughly guarded
These broken screens of isolation.

Their bitter sharpness I can feel…

And leaning along the trembling wall of sorrow
I let my eyes meet the betraying layer of the ground…
And there I see them, stabbing my glance –
The anguished stains of blood
Gleaming on the cursed pieces of glass –
Undignified witnesses to a specter’s misdeed,
Unpredictable fortunetellers of an angel child
Whose only yearning wish was to die.
